System and method for detecting the position of a tailgate and adjusting operation of a user interface device based on the tailgate position

Abstract

A system includes an object identification module, a tailgate position module, and a user interface device (UID) control module. The object identification module is configured to identify at least one of a bumper of a vehicle and a tailgate of the vehicle in an image captured by a camera mounted to the tailgate. The tailgate position module is configured to determine that the tailgate is closed when the bumper is identified in the image, and determine that the tailgate is open when at least one of: the tailgate is identified in the image; and the bumper is not identified in the image. The UID control module is configured to adjust operation of a user interface device based on whether the tailgate is open or closed.

Claims (70)

1. A system comprising:

an object detection circuit configured to detect a first object in a first image captured by a camera mounted to a tailgate of a vehicle;

an object identification circuit configured to identify the first object as one of the tailgate and a bumper of the vehicle when at least one of:

a shape of the first object corresponds to a predetermined shape;

a size of the first object corresponds to a predetermined size; and

a location of the first object corresponds to a predetermined location;

a tailgate position circuit configured to:

determine that the tailgate is closed based on the bumper being identified in the first image captured by the camera; and

determine that the tailgate is open based on:

the tailgate being identified in the first image captured by the camera; and

the bumper not being identified in the first image captured by the camera; and

a user interface device (UID) control circuit configured to at least one of:

control a user interface device to display a perspective view image of a first area rearward of the vehicle, to display guidelines representing a travel path of the vehicle over the perspective view image, and to adjust the guidelines based on whether the tailgate is open or closed; and

control the user interface device to alert a driver when the vehicle is approaching a second object located rearward of the vehicle and within a first distance of the vehicle, and to adjust the first distance based on whether the tailgate is open or closed, wherein the user interface device alerts the driver by at least one of playing a sound and generating a vibration.

2. The system of claim 1 wherein the object identification circuit is configured to identify the first object as the bumper when the first object appears at a bottom edge of the first image captured by the camera and the at least one of:

the shape of the first object corresponds to the predetermined shape of the bumper; and

the size of the first object corresponds to the predetermined size of the bumper.

3. The system of claim 1 wherein the object identification circuit is configured to identify the first object as the tailgate when the first object appears at a top edge of the first image captured by the camera and the at least one of:

the shape of the first object corresponds to the predetermined shape of the tailgate; and

the size of the first object corresponds to the predetermined size of the tailgate.
